在iOS模拟器上安装程式的ios-sim

针对iOS装置进行开发时,绝大部分开发者采用的工具都是官方的Xcode。问题是负责图像设计和开发管理人员,却不一定熟悉Xcode的操作,这时ios-sim便是一个解决方案。

曾经从事iOS开发的朋友,相信也会发现如果要把编译好给iOS的程式,在不经App Store的情况下分发给其他人在实机上测试,将会是一件非常麻烦的事。ios-sim是一个在Mac OS X上执行的开源软体,目的是让图像设计师和管理人员等非开发者,也能将原本编译好给iOS的程式,放在iOS模拟器上执行。ios-sim是一个在终端机上执行的程式,执行ios-sim时以参数形式指定该iOS应用程式即可。完成后该程式会自动被安装到iOS模拟器上,马上就可以使用。执行ios-sim时也可指定SDK的版本,或指定只可在iPhone/iPad上执行。能够马上查出SDK的版本,对开发者而言也是十分有用的功能。

时间: 2024-10-02 18:20:25

在iOS模拟器上安装程式的ios-sim的相关文章

iOS模拟器上NSHomeDirectory和resourcePath的根路径不同

今天运行模拟器程序里访问一个.app里面的文件,用NSHomeDirectory与文件名拼接居然访问不了,然后就发现一个奇怪的问题: iOS模拟器上NSHomeDirectory和resourcePath的根路径居然是不同的. 上代码: NSLog(@"resourcePath is %@", [[NSBundle mainBundle]resourcePath]); NSLog(@"NSHomeDirectory is %@", NSHomeDirectory()

appium1.6在mac上环境搭建启动ios模拟器上Safari浏览器

前言 在mac上搭建appium踩了不少坑,先是版本低了,启动后无限重启模拟器.后来全部升级最新版本,就稳稳的了. 环境准备: 1.OS版本号10.12 2.xcode版本号8.3.2 3.appium版本号1.6.4(appium-desktop1.1.0) 4.ios模拟器版本号10.3 一.OS10.12 1.这里Mac上的OS系统一定要升级到10.12,低于10.12是无法安装8.3.2的xcode版本的 2.下载地址:https://www.apple.com/macos/sierra

终端:Xcode模拟器上安装.app方法

有的时候,我们可能需要将别人的Xcode运行之后的程序包(xxx.app)安装在自己的模拟器上,如下我将介绍如何通过终端来安装. 实现 获取自己Xcode生成的xxx.app steps 1:在工程didFinishLaunchingWithOptions:方法中打印bundle路径: NSLog(@"%@", [[NSBundlemainBundle] pathForAuxiliaryExecutable:@""]); steps 2:拷贝打印的bundle路径,

如何在Android模拟器上安装apk文件

1.运行SDK Manager,选择模拟器,并运行模拟器 SDK Manager应用 2.将需要安装的apk文件复制到platform-tools目录下(默认在:C:\Program Files\Android\android-sdk-windows\platform-tools ).为安装方便,这里将其命名为game.apk 3.点击开始→运行,输入cmd,打开cmd窗口.输入cd C:\Program Files\android-sdk-windows\platform-tools,进入pl

ios模拟器已安装但xcode无法显示

最近把系统抹盘重装了, 然后用Time Machine恢复到原始状态, 一切安好, 但是使用xcode的时候发现一个模拟器都没有了: 各种折腾, 重装SDK啊, 重装xcode啊,最后发现, 如果你的simulator(/Applications/Xcode/Contents/Developer/Applications/iOS Simulator) 和SDK(/Applications/Xcode/Contents/Developer/Platforms/iPhoneSimulator.pla

ios模拟器上下黑条

环境 Xcode6.0.1 问题 新建单视图工程,删除故事板和启动xib,模拟器启动后不管选4s还是5,屏幕尺寸始终返回320*480,即出现上下黑条. 分析 实在找不出原因,可能是xcode自身问题,按网上方案添加一张640*1136的图片,比如[email protected],即可.

如何在未越狱iOS设备上安装IPA

转载自:http://blog.163.com/l1_jun/blog/static/1438638820133505210779/ 2013-04-05 12:52:10|  分类: Apple|字号 订阅 Ad-Hoc 是苹果公司是为应用发布提供的一种发布前测试方法,所要安装的设备无需越狱.  其用途在于:如果你开发了一款App, 想在发布之前,让周围人帮忙测试一下. 这时,你需要得到测试人的设备的 UDID,  生成一个 Ad-Hoc 应用,并将该应用和对应的 mobileProvisio

【转】模拟器上安装googleplay apk

原文网址:http://blog.sina.com.cn/s/blog_9fc2ff230101gv57.html 1.进入到sdk\android-sdk-windows\tools>目录下: 1>启动模拟器游戏:4.4 模拟器名称 已经存在的模拟器 输入: emulator -avd 4.4 -partition-size 300 -no-audio -no-boot-anim 2>模拟器启动完成    输入:adb shell 输入:mount rootfs / rootfs ro

flash bulider 生成app无法安装在xcode模拟器上

使用flash bulider开发app在ios模拟器上运行,出现以下错误 错误提示是isb与当前设备的osx不符合.当前使用airsdk版本是4.0,xcode5.1.1. 查看了air13sdk的更新说明有这个提示: 查看了air14sdk的更新说明有这个提示: md,这就是个坑啊....... 故升级到最新的air14sdk.ok,可以在xcode的ios模拟器上安装flashbuilder的app了. flash bulider 生成app无法安装在xcode模拟器上